Grasping Toner Cartridge Lifespan
The lifespan of a toner cartridge is a crucial aspect for companies seeking to maximize printing productivity. Numerous factors can influence the span of time a cartridge will reliably produce high-quality prints. These include how often you print, the kind of printer, the grade of toner employed, and even environmental conditions.
- Recognizing these influential factors allows you to arrive at more savvy choices about purchasing toner cartridges and can help you prevent costly costs.
Finding Toner Cartridges: A Comprehensive Buying Guide
Embarking on the quest for fresh toner cartridges can feel like navigating a labyrinth. With a plethora of options available, it's easy to become overwhelmed. This comprehensive buying guide will empower you with the knowledge needed to make informed toner cartridges that perfectly match your printing needs.
- First identifying your printer type. Toner cartridge specifications are strictly associated to your printer model.
- Assess your printing frequency. High-volume printers require cartridges with greater capacities.
- Investigate different toner cartridge types, such as compatible and recycled, each offering unique advantages and cost structures.
Bear this in mind that original toner cartridges often provide optimal print results but tend to be more expensive.
